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to remove the water and dry your laundry room.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ential areas of concern.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We employ advanced equipment, including heavy-duty pumps and wet/dry vacuums, to extract water from your laundry room. This process is critical to pre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team uses specialized drying fans and dehumidifiers to dry your laundry room completely, ensuring that every surface is free of moisture and safe for use.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We thoroughly clean and sanitize your laundry room to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This includes disinfecting all surfaces, fixtures, and equipment.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Report
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that your laundry room is safe and functional. We provide a detailed report outlining the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ance or repairs.

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| Small leaks are usually easy to contain and fix with DIY methods. |
| Large water leak (over 1 gallon) | No | Yes | Larger le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to contain and fix. |
| Water damage behind walls or under flooring | No | Yes | Hidden moisture need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and fix.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ent future growth. |
| Water damage under appliances | No | Yes | Leaks under appliances need specialized equipment and expertise to contain and fix. |
| Laundry room water damage with electrical issues | No | Yes | Electrical issues need specialized expertise and equipment to safely and effectively fix. |

Q: What causes laundry room water damage?
A: Laundry room water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including appliance malfunctions, clogged drains, and water supply line leaks.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these issues.
